Online Approaches for Skill Building and Emotional Regulation

Esther commonly uses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) to help clients identify and shift unhelpful thinking patterns and behaviors; this approach is often applied to anxiety, mood concerns, and some addiction-related habits. She also integrates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) skills-focused strategies to teach practical techniques for emotion regulation, distress tolerance, and interpersonal effectiveness when intense feelings or reactivity are present.
